Skip to content

2.1.3

Compare
Choose a tag to compare
@DevinWalker DevinWalker released this 24 May 04:09
· 16856 commits to develop since this release
  • [closed] fix(admin-donation): reset email receipt donation button popup should open using modal api #3244
  • [closed] fix(donation): formatAmount fn should use the format argument correctly. #3238
  • [closed] fix(admin-form): Fix tooltip language on Donation Form Grid columns field #3235
  • [closed] Typos on Set-up guide #3230
  • [closed] [Give 2.1.2] Post settings disappearing when plugin enabled #3229
  • [closed] fix(admin-tool): getting PHP notices when exporting donor in lower PHP version #3222
  • [closed] fix(admin-donor): getting PHP notice when update donor address #3220
  • [closed] fix(admin-tool): getting PHP notices when exporting donor #3218
  • [1-reported][high-priority] fix(compat): beaver builder conflict preventing from seeing page builder element on backend. #3207
  • [urgent] fix(donation): delete donation metadata when delete donation #3205
  • [closed] fix(currency-switcher): amount should be formatted based on the currency I switched into. #3203
  • [closed] fix(donations): add autocomplete attributes to form fields #3202
  • [high-priority] fix(donations): resolve often reported "Error: Nonce verification has failed." #3200
  • [3-reported][urgent] fix(donation): Address why donations are saved to the DB as $0 when memcache is enabled on Dreamhost #3199
  • [closed] feat(admin-form): Ability to toggle a per form Test Mode #3196
  • [closed] fix(admin-form): add logic to customize chosen form dropdown arguments #3192
  • [1-reported] fix(give-api): Make Earnings and Donations Types Respect Daterange as intended #3191
  • [closed] fix(donation): auto select the default level when donation form load for the first time #3184
  • [closed] fix(donation): focusing out of custom amount field without adding an amount leaves 0.00 as amount #3181
  • [high-priority][urgent] fix(admin-donation): focusing out of amount fields remove error message #3179
  • [urgent] fix(form): allow set donations with custom amount disabled #3178
  • [urgent] fix(donation): ensure minimum donation is accurate with , separator #3176
  • [closed] fix(admin-settings): render nonce on setting page even if save button hidden #3172
  • [3-reported] fix(compat): shortcode dropdown appearing in Elementor TinyMCE editor window #3171
  • [urgent] fix(shortcode): clarify Donation Form Grid shortcode generator #3166
  • [closed] fix(admin-setting): prevent setting menu to appear on top of modal #3164
  • [urgent] fix(db-update): prevent blank screen when updating 2.0.6 to 2.1.0 #3163
  • [closed] fix(admin-form): prevent js notice when edit price type setting field #3161
  • [urgent] fix(donation): prevent maximum custom amount error #3159
  • [closed] fix(admin-dashboard): correct weekly donation total in dashboard widget #3156
  • [closed] fix(admin-plugins): update notice shouldn't display when actively updating add-ons #3155
  • [closed] fix(admin-plugins): display activation banner immediately upon activation refresh #3153
  • [closed] fix(shortcode): add missing options to [give_form_grid] generator #3147
  • [high-priority] feat(form): ensure w3c validations for donation forms' ID to resolve Stripe Elements issue #3139
  • [closed] fix(admin-form): Make Range-slider more practical when setting the minimum amount #3135
  • [closed] perf(query): reduce code/query for getting information about activation banner. #3130
  • [closed] perf(query): reduce sql query for getting information about active licenses #3128
  • [closed] fix(admin-notice): implement Give Modal in db upgrade process #3127
  • [closed] fix(admin-donation): delete donation note popup should open using modal api #3123
  • [closed] fix(form): min/max input field appearing even if custom amount is disabled. #3122
  • [closed] fix(donation): pending donations should not be counted for donor goal #3121
  • [closed] fix(admin-tool): fix typo in filter declaration #3120
  • [closed] fix(donation): Database unknown column error on processing donation #3119
  • [closed] feat(admin-tools): Add Donor ID to the Export Donation History Export #3118
  • [closed] feat(admin-setting): add chosen when selected Base Country #3117
  • [closed] fix(donation-alert): Add the correct "Maximum" donation message #3115
  • [closed] fix(admin-tool): update CSV files that import donation #3114
  • [closed] design(admin-gateway): UI for Enabled Gateways is getting break on load #3113
  • [10-reported][high-priority] feat(admin-email): Add "Email Heading" as a customizable setting for all Emails #3110
  • [closed] style(admin-export): column alignment issue #3097
  • [1-reported][needs-confirmation] fix(donation-form): Don't clear form fields via JS if no Give form is present on the page #3093
  • [high-priority] fix(admin-settings): load default company field settings on fresh install #3079
  • [closed] fix(admin-report): PHP notice of Undefined index: orderby on donation method. #3077
  • [closed] fix(db-update): disable db upgrade notice on fresh install #3074
  • [closed] fix(cli): Incorrect earning format for wp give report command #3073
  • [closed] fix(admin-tool): removed currency html code from export column head #3072
  • [high-priority][needs-dev-feedback] feat(admin-tool): add columns for subscription payments number of rene #3071
  • [closed] perf(cache): improve query which process during flush cache #3069
  • [high-priority] fix(admin-form): hide donor goal setting field when goal disabled #3068
  • [closed] style(cache): remove typo from action name #3067
  • [closed] fix(admin-tool): fix typo on importer and improve layout #3064
  • [closed] fix(admin-donor): clicking edit username needs to display message in new modal api #3063
  • [closed] fix(donation): prevent extra query generates from give_get_gateway_admin_label #3062
  • [urgent] refactor(cache): add filter in filter_group_name fn #3061
  • [closed] fix(donation): php warning on #3059
  • [needs-design-feedback] feat(admin-tool): add columns to separate export field types #3053
  • [closed] fix(admin-plugins): map_meta_cap notice on plugin disablement #3052
  • [closed] fix(admin-tool): exporting donation history progress bar keeps loading after 100% #3049
  • [closed] feat(admin-exports): add "Currency Code" and "Currency Symbol" column to donation exports #3048
  • [closed] fix(admin-tools): correct exported field issues with duplicated standard fields and missing cat/tag filter #3047
  • [closed] fix(donation): donation number on donation history page should not have # as prefix #3044
  • [urgent] fix(admin-tool): export donation history should have donation number #3043
  • [urgent] fix(admin-settings): Give api should have donation id instead of donation number #3042
  • [closed] fix(form): auto open form modal JS code is not working #3030
  • [closed] fix(form): do not output formatted value in form #3029
  • [closed] feat(form): display goal stats on form detail page #3027
  • [closed] fix(form): getting js error when get back to page with form grid shortcode #3019
  • [closed] fix(admin-settings): General setting page style is broken #3018
  • [urgent] fix(form): getting js error if addon disabled #3017
  • [closed] fix(admin-settings): cache cleared popup should use new modal api #3016
  • [closed] refactor(admin-tool): reorder Admin tool tabs #3015
  • [1-reported] fix(i18n): Use html entities for currency symbols in admin labels #3014
  • [1-reported] fix(i18n): Miscellaneous string updates based on translator feedback #3013
  • [10-reported][high-priority] feat(template): implement optional honorifics/titles for Donor name. #3011
  • [closed] fix(goals): switching gateways converts donor count to currency count #3010
  • [closed] fix(admin-tool): export donation history progress bar need alignment with spacing #3009
  • [closed] fix(admin-report): graph related js file is not loading #3005
  • [closed] fix(admin-tool): getting PHP notices when importing Give core Settings #2999
  • [closed] fix(admin-tool): PHP notices on system info page #2998
  • [3-reported][high-priority] feat(admin-tool): maximize extensibility of reports and exports pages/functionality #2996
  • [urgent] fix(admin-tool): Fix JS error caused while importing Give Donation #2994
  • [closed] fix(admin-settings): sequential ordering settings duplicates donation id displayed #2991
  • [closed] perf(form): improve helper function which calculate total form earning #2989
  • [1-reported] feat(goals): add new "number of donors" goal #2986
  • [closed] fix(importer): PHP warning when importing donations. #2982
  • [1-reported] fix(compat): correctly display Give Shortcode generator on category archive editor. #2980
  • [closed] fix(admin-tools): sorting donation with date is failing #2978
  • [closed] fix(admin-donations): sequential ordering should show # as default prefix to donation ids #2977
  • [closed] How can I remove Credit Card Info form on my website? #2974
  • [urgent] fix(admin-tool): Fix JS error caused while importing Give Settings #2972
  • [closed] perf(donations): improve query performance on frontend for donation payment queries #2968
  • [5-reported] fix(admin-tool): clarify donor export settings #2964
  • [urgent] fix(admin-form): max / min slider appears broken and field title needs updating #2963
  • [urgent] build: resolve issue when running "npm run build" #2962
  • [closed] test(phpunit): add unit tests for importer #2961
  • [closed] fix(gutenberg): ensure Give Form Grid block can be inserted #2960
  • [closed] test(phpunit): fix broken tests in 2.1 #2959
  • [closed] fix(admin-plugins): correct number of plugins for Give filter #2953
  • [closed] fix(donation): polish sequential ordering #2952
  • [closed] fix(shortcode): load modal forms in form grid via AJAX #2951
  • [closed] feat(admin-importer): Add company name fields at the time of Importing Donation CSV #2946
  • [closed] Can't add a new custom currency with My Custom Functions #2944
  • [closed] feat(grid): improve UX/UI of donation form grid #2943
  • [closed] fix(admin-donation): new donor not getting auto assign to donation #2940
  • [closed] fix(admin-settings): prevent default setting for disabled gateways #2939
  • [closed] fix(activation-banner): improve activation scenarios when single banner and multi-banner displays #2938
  • [closed] feat(donor): add get donor address method to Give_Donor Class #2935
  • [closed] fix(export): get JS notice when donation history export complete #2932
  • [closed] Hook mismatch #2931
  • [high-priority] fix(donation): prevent $0 donation spam #2930
  • [needs-confirmation] fix(admin-donation): Allow saving donation details #2928
  • [closed] doc(composer): Update README after changes in streamline local development changes #2922
  • [closed] fix(admin-tool): duplicate donation are also getting imported from CSV #2921
  • [closed] sequential #2916
  • [closed] test(donation): test sequential ordering feature #2915
  • [closed] feat(donation): implement developer helper function for sequential ordering feature #2914
  • [needs-dev-feedback] feat(admin-setting): implement admin setting for sequential ordering #2913
  • [needs-dev-feedback] feat(donation): implement sequential ordering #2912
  • [closed] feat(woocommerce): add per order global setting to enable donations. #2911
  • [closed] build(webpack): Bundle SVG files inside correct folder #2907
  • [closed] refactor(admin-plugins): combine notices to singular tabbed interface #2903
  • [closed] design(admin-plugins): improve content tab layout for add-on activations #2902
  • [closed] Evaluate existing Give-Display-Donors shortcode for functionality #2899
  • [closed] build(composer): commit composer.lock file #2896
  • [closed] refactor(form): simplify usage of localized variables for js #2895
  • [closed] fix(gutenberg): prevent fatal error if Gutenberg not activated #2891
  • [closed] fix(admin-tool): ensure billing address is imported completely #2884
  • [closed] feat(compat): share goal progress across multiple forms using WPML #2883
  • [closed] fix(donation-amount): INR amount in frontend is not formatting correctly. #2882
  • [closed] fix(gutenberg): give notices should not display within the gutenberg editor #2880
  • [closed] fix(admin-donation): Donation Importer not working in release/2.0.7 branch #2879
  • [10-reported][needs-docs] feat(admin-tool): merge CSV toolbox into Give core #2875
  • [closed] fix(donation): detect if amount is already formatted #2874
  • [closed] give ffm using 'startsWith' function #2873
  • [closed] bug(admin-notices): Auto dismiss of front-end notices does not work #2869
  • [closed] fix(form-settings): auto set focus to amount field #2866
  • [closed] fix(bug): Only show message about options if options are available #2864
  • [closed] feat(form): disallow email address as first name #2862
  • [closed] fix(form): allow amount to be changed multiple times #2861
  • [closed] fix(frontend-js): uncaught type error due to change in unFormatCurrency in 2.0.5 #2860
  • [closed] Card not valid message positions #2857
  • [closed] feat(admin-tool): Add button to automate creating API key for current user #2855
  • [closed] fix(notice): Dismiss button is missing in Give notices in front-end. #2853
  • [closed] feat(cli): add command to activate test environment for donation #2845
  • [closed] refactor(give-block): Improve UI/UX of Give's Gutenberg block #2843
  • [closed] fix(ffm): prevent Form Field Manager from affecting other dropdown menus #2827
  • [closed] feat(email): display any meta data with dynamic email tags #2801
  • [closed] fix(shortcode): display form title even if form is closed #2800
  • [closed] build(composer): streamline local development setup #2798
  • [closed] fix(tooltip): remove HTML from tooltips #2796
  • [closed] feat(admin-plugins): display inline notification before updating #2789
  • [closed] doc: define roles of README.md, CONTRIBUTING.md, and Wiki #2781
  • [closed] feat(form): set roadmap for Gutenberg integration #2748
  • [closed] feat(admin-donation): add delete button to single donation screen #2734
  • [closed] Shortcode generator issue with inserting Donation Form goal #2728
  • [5-reported][high-priority][urgent] Import doesn't import Donations or Donors in version 2.0.1 #2725
  • [closed] feat(admin-setting): clear Give Cache from within Advanced tab #2719
  • [closed] perf(admin-setting): cache queries used in page settings #2718
  • [closed] fix(update): animate progress bar during update #2709
  • [closed] fix(notice): notify donor if form is submitted with unchecked Terms #2684
  • [closed] fix(db-update): ensure emails are maintained after 2.0 update #2672
  • [closed] feat(admin-email): add Email Recipients section to donor emails #2657
  • [closed] fix(form): display actual goal progress even after goal is met #2638
  • [closed] fix(gateway): prevent PHP notice if no gateway is active #2578
  • [closed] Create new page for Give Profile Editor on Fresh install #2552
  • [closed] fix(emails): Special char display for currency sign for the Plain text Email type. #2515
  • [closed] Email Preview show HTML view for the Plain text option #2514
  • [closed] design(gutenberg): give gutenberg block concept #2456
  • [closed] feat(form): display Company field in donation form #2453
  • [closed] Deleting All Donations using Bulk Delete should Give Customised Blank Slate Page #2448
  • [closed] feat(admin-setting): improve success/failed/history page settings #2445
  • [closed] Not able to tell differences between payment gateways due to same labels #2429
  • [closed] feat(admin-tool): Create new "Dry Run" functionality to test importing donation #2419
  • [closed] Add label for donation goal in dashboard #2338
  • [closed] Support multiple form goals within the [give_goal] shortcode #2295
  • [closed] Add support for middle initial / name #2277
  • [3-reported][high-priority] feat(form): allow forms to be queried based on close status #2250
  • [1-reported] fix(admin-exports): export Donors in csv does not export multiple donation forms that donor has donated to. #2223
  • [closed] Add additional .give-active-level class to multi-level buttons and radios field types #2217
  • [closed] Improve importer logic to set currency of donation #2215
  • [closed] Duplicate Form ID when Same Form Multiple time #2200
  • [closed] Make default Credit Card field one line, ala Stripe #2167
  • [closed] fix(admin-tool): prevent duplicates if same date with different time #2166
  • [closed] fix(admin-importer): do not auto-map custom fields #2163
  • [closed] Give Importer: Add sample import file as an example #2065
  • [Epic] epic(admin-plugins): combine activation notices into tabbed interface #2056
  • [closed] fix(admin-menu): display Donation forms in Edit Menus tab by default #2045
  • [closed] perf: improve code by processing unrelated tasks as async jobs #2020
  • [closed] feat(form): allow form configs to be imported and exported #2012
  • [closed] Create main "Dashboard" screen with high-level reports that lead to detailed reports #1993
  • [closed] Consider ways to enable admins to customize all form labels and tooltips #1953
  • [closed] fix(donor): adding Multiple Shortcodes on same page should not ask for login multiple times #1945
  • [closed] Minimum and maximum donation amount slider #1920
  • [closed] fix(admin-form): ensure form always publishes in usable state #1688
  • [closed] feat(modal): create modal API to replace JS alerts #1475
  • [closed] feat(shortcode): add [give_totals] shortcode #1472
  • [closed] feat(form): identify areas of improvement for existing forms #1457
  • [closed] feat(grid): display multiple forms in a grid #1414
  • [closed] feat(cli): update add-ons from GitHub #1390
  • [closed] design(gateway): replace default CC images with SVG library #1382
  • [closed] Create autocomplete feature for email shortcodes #1330
  • [closed] Allow for currencies to be set per-form programatically #1307
  • [closed] Handle give_field_is_required() differently #1212
  • [closed] Plugin loads resources in non-performant ways. #1211
  • [closed] Can we delete logs and payments infomation of deleted form #1094
  • [closed] feat(form): identify form-building concerns and possible Fields API #1038
  • [closed] Fix non-donation / ecommerce terminology in actions and filters #896
  • [closed] Include custom form fields values in CSV donor exports? #744
  • [closed] Improve Scrutinizer Score #675
  • [closed] Create Give Form Placeholder with Shortcode Builder #484
  • [closed] Update JS with ES6 standard code #339
  • [Epic][high-priority] epic(donation): enable sequential ordering #244